Year-Round Lake Use in Malakoff: what to expect

Cedar Creek is a TRWD raw-water reservoir held at a steady managed elevation, which removes the seasonal water-level anxiety that haunts Lake Palestine or Richland-Chambers owners — but that does not mean Malakoff docks run themselves year-round without thought. The southwest wind that pounds this end of the lake from late spring through early fall drives chop that can damage a lift, loosen a piling connection, or make a light dock feel dangerous during a summer squall.

  • Fixed-height decking is the correct system for Cedar Creek's stable TRWD pool — we design deck height once with confidence, without Palestine-style drawdown margins.
  • Lift guide-pile bracing on southwest-exposed slips in Pine Cove and Wedgewood is sized for the afternoon chop, not just calm-day loading.
  • Marine-grade hardware, stainless fasteners, and composite or pressure-treated decking rated for the Henderson County moisture cycle extend the useful season without annual refurbishment.
  • Lighting and electrical brought to current TRWD standards during a replacement build enable evening use, which doubles the effective use window during the shoulder season.
  • We design the gangway connection to handle the minor seasonal temperature-driven movement typical on this stretch without loosening over a five-year cycle.

How this plays out around Malakoff

Malakoff anchors the southwest end of Cedar Creek Lake. Long industrial heritage in clay and brick — and a growing waterfront pocket along the lake's southern shoreline as legacy lots come back on market.

The Malakoff side of Cedar Creek sees prevailing southwest wind on summer afternoons, which favors deeper pilings and rigid bulkhead designs over floating systems. TRWD permitting runs through the same shoreline office as the Gun Barrel side, but cap-elevation enforcement is tighter where private lots back directly to TRWD-managed shoreline. Older docks here are often 1970s-era and replacements have to step up to modern decking, lighting, and electrical standards in the TRWD packet.
